CHAPTER 5 LASER EXPOSURE SYSTEM
III. LASER DRIVER CIRCUIT
A. Controlling the Laser System
The laser driver circuit converts video signals (VD0 to VD7) into laser intensity control signals
used to drive the semiconductor laser.
The laser driver circuit has the following functions:
1.
Controlling laser emission.
2.
Controlling the laser intensity (APC control).
3.
Switching laser outputs.
Each of the signals has the following function:
1.
PH/TX/h200 (switch signal to suit copying mode)
Serves to switch resolutions in main scanning direction (i.e., to suit text output or photo
output; in sub scanning direction, it is fixed to 400 dpi).
2.
PVE (sync signal)
Serves as the sync signal when transmitting video signals.
3.
400* Signal
Serves to select 400 dpi when '1'.
